PLC and DCS: How Do They Differ & How Did They Come About?
By Mondi Anderson, RealPars A DCS or distributed control system is similar to a PLC in that it has rugged computer controllers, however, the DCS contains multiple autonomous controllers that are distributed throughout a system, also used for automating processes. -

LNS Survey: Industrial companies using safety to increase profitability
75 percent of industrial companies said they have seen operational improvements resulting from the use of advanced safety technology. Similarly, 60 percent of respondents said they have seen financial improvements resulting from the use of advanced safety technology. -

Safety over EtherCAT approved as Chinese National Standard
EtherCAT itself has been a Chinese recommended standard since 2014. With FSoE now also reaching this official status, end users, system integrators and device manufacturers alike have the reassurance that the entire EtherCAT technology ecosystem is fully accepted in China -
